Try adjusting the grinder to a lower number...only turn it when it's actually grinding..this makes for a finer grind and richer flavor. Next push the button next to the bean icon to three reds before starting a brew...this will increase the size of the coffee puck for brewing...you may also want to lower the amount of liquid in your cup with the icon next to bean icon...It takes some patience and trial and error but it's worth it.

It could also be the beans you're using as you really benefit from new, oily beans when using an espresso machine. If they dry out too much, it won't brew correctly as the water passes through too quickly to absorb.
